Volkswagen Tayron R-Line launched at Rs 46.99 lakh: All about Fortuner’s new rival

Volkswagen India has launched the all new Tayron R-Line in India at a price of Rs 46.99 lakh ex showroom. The SUV will be brought to India as a completely knocked down unit (CKD) and will be assembled at Volkswagen’s Chatrapathi Sambhajinagar facility (Aurangabad). 2026 Nissan Gravite Launched at Rs 5.65 lakhs: All Details Here

Nissan Motor India has officially launched the new Nissan Gravite compact MPV in India, marking the brand’s entry into the affordable three-row people-mover space. Priced at an introductory price of ₹5.65 lakhs ex-showroom, with bookings opening tonight.
